Job Details
Job Description
Responsibilities
Oversee and manage full payroll operations for 4000+ employees across multiple entities.
Develop, implement, and maintain payroll policies, procedures, and internal controls.
Ensure compliance with all payroll-related legislation and tax requirements.
Collaborate with Finance and HR to ensure accurate data flow and alignment with accounting calendars.
Prepare and process payroll GL entries, variance analyses, and monthly reconciliations.
Identify, investigate, and resolve payroll discrepancies with corrective action plans.
Prepare and submit tax filings, including bi-annual SARS submissions.
Support internal and external audits with required documentation and explanations.
Manage complex employee payroll queries with accuracy and professionalism.
Lead, mentor, and develop a team of payroll specialists and administrators.
Handle EMP201 submissions, WCA return of earnings, provident fund linking, vehicle and petrol tax updates, leave system accuracy, and ESS alignment.
Process terminations, monthly payment reconciliations, deduction reconciliations, and bank payment uploads.
Load salary costs on Salesforce for approval, post journals on Acumatica, and maintain all earning lines and calculation methods.
Successfully onboard new companies onto payroll systems and manage all statutory registrations.
Provide statistical reports to HR and government (UIF, etc.), weekly/monthly payroll expenditure reports, and manage ESS usage.
Drive innovation through automation, system optimisation, and AI-enabled payroll improvements.
Requirements
Bachelor’s degree in Accounting, Finance, Business Administration, or related field.
Minimum 10 years’ end-to-end payroll experience, including management or supervisory roles.
Strong understanding of accounting principles and payroll-related financial reporting.
Extensive knowledge of payroll legislation, tax regulations, and statutory requirements (SARS, UIF, SDL, BCEA, PSIRA or MIBCO).
Proficiency in Sage 300 and advanced Excel (formulas, pivot tables, reconciliations).
Strong analytical, problem-solving, and numerical skills with exceptional attention to detail.
Excellent communication and interpersonal skills for stakeholder engagement.
Strong ability to work under pressure and meet strict, non-negotiable deadlines.
Willingness to travel to client branches when required (40+ entities).
Systems Used
Sage 300
Acumatica
Salesforce
ERS Biometrics
ESS
WCA / RMA Online
SARS Online Systems
Online Banking Platforms
Microsoft Suite (Advanced)
Benefits
- Salary: Based on experience and qualifications.
Contact Hire Resolve for your next career-changing move today
- Apply for this role today, contact Gustav Vogel at Hire Resolve or on LinkedIn
- You can also visit the Hire Resolve website: hireresolve.us or email us your CV: [email protected]
- Please use "Payroll Manager" as your subject line when applying via email
We will contact you telephonically in 3 days should you be suitable for this vacancy. If you are not suitable, we will put your CV on file and contact you regarding any future